Transaction fe5429497613119d00e249a23ef029dd5feaff92d058c43b37c16eb17828ff24

1 Input
2 Outputs
  • fe5429497613119d00e249a23ef029dd5feaff92d058c43b37c16eb17828ff24:0
  • value  2762
    address  34SgmFjWgH4W7krXzGAoTHG2qR7bb9ht88
  • fe5429497613119d00e249a23ef029dd5feaff92d058c43b37c16eb17828ff24:1
  • value  15809
    address  12QN1LweeEY45eYJFt1TRnX45iRK73t7HC